On 05/13/2022, Commerce initiated a scope inquiry on whether cabinet organizers imported by Rev-A-Shelf, LLC (RAS) are covered by the scope of the antidumping and countervailing duty orders on wooden cabinets and vanities and components thereof from the People's Republic of China (China) (A-570-106/C-570-107). See message 2139417. 2. On 06/27/2022, Commerce rescinded the scope inquiry of the antidumping and countervailing duty orders on wooden cabinets and vanities and components thereof from the People's Republic of China (A-570-106/C-570-107). 3. Continue to suspend liquidation of entries of cabinets and vanities and components thereof from the People's Republic of China that are subject to the antidumping and countervailing duty orders on cabinets and vanities and components thereof from the People's Republic of China at the applicable rates in effect on the date of entry until liquidation instructions are issued. 4. In accordance with 19 CFR 351.225(l)(5), this instruction does not affect or otherwise limit CBP's independent authority to take any additional action with respect to the suspension of liquidation or related measures. 5.
